Orenco offers a variety of training courses for contractors, designers, service providers, and regulators. Classes are conducted by our training department via webinars and live workshops at our corporate headquarters in Sutherlin, Oregon, as well as through our distributors. Many of our courses qualify for CEUs and other state-specific continuing education requirements. Information on upcoming live trainings appears below. Pumps and Controls are an integral part of most onsite septic systems, and they come in all shapes and sizes. In this training, we’ll cover various pump types and explain how to size and use them for onsite systems. We’ll then discuss types of controls, the options available, and how they are used in different applications.. 0.5 OESAC CEU's offered.
